IRAN CYBER DIALOGUE

IRAN, INTERNET, OPPORTUNITIES AND CHALLENGES

March 5-6, 2015, Valencia, Spain
AGENDA

DAY 1: Thursday, March 5, 2015 (Public)


   -

   Panel: Iran and the West: International security, internet policy and
   diplomacy.
   -

   Panel: Technology as Catalyst: Will the evolving tech ecosystem support
   better online access to information?
   -

   Panel: Building Effective Responses to Opportunities and Challenges: Given
   the opportunities and challenges in Iran’s tech ecosystem, how can we
   formulate effective responses?
   -

   Live Product Launches and Product Demos
   -

   Private Agenda Hacking for Day 2’s Hands-on Sessions facilitated


DAY 2: Friday, March 6, 2015 (Pre-Registered Only)

A full-day of workshops and panels, attended only by pre-registered
guests. Approximately
10-11 hands-on outcome-driven sessions. By attending, all participants
agree to abide by the Chatham House Rule
<http://www.chathamhouse.org/about/chatham-house-rule>. Here’s a tentative
list of sessions, with more to come!
